      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;The&amp;nbsp;black BT Complete WiFi discs don't work with&amp;nbsp;the current EE Smart Hub Plus/Pro routers. It's only the&amp;nbsp;white BT "High St." Whole Home discs that do&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;You may order&amp;nbsp;&lt;A class="" href="https://ee.co.uk/content/dam/help/terms-and-conditions/broadband/smart-wifi-terms-and-conditions/ee-smart-wifi-essentials-all-rounder-and-full-works-plans.pdf"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"&gt;Smart WiFi and Smart WiFi Plus&lt;/A&gt;&amp;nbsp;for £7 pm &amp;amp; get up to 3 Smart WiFi Plus extenders to cover the house.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
